Why CMA USA Is Different from Traditional Accounting Courses
Most accounting programs focus heavily on compliance, taxation, and historical reporting. The CMA USA, however, is centred on:
- Financial planning and analysis (FP&A)
- Cost control and management
- Budgeting and forecasting
- Strategic decision-making
- Performance management
These skills make CMAs indispensable to CEOs, CFOs, and business leaders, and create career opportunities across industries—IT, manufacturing, banking, consulting, healthcare, logistics, retail, and more.
Top Career Paths After CMA USA
-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) Analyst
One of the most sought-after roles for CMAs, FP&A analysts guide company budgets, forecasts, and financial strategies. They help leadership decide where to invest, cut costs, or scale.
- Management Accountant
This is a core CMA role involving internal financial analysis, performance monitoring, cost optimisation, and strategic planning. Unlike traditional accounting, it focuses on business decision-making, not compliance.
- Cost Accountant
Companies rely on cost accountants to track production costs, reduce waste, price products correctly, and improve profitability—especially in manufacturing, supply chain, and FMCG industries.
- Business Analyst
With strong analytical and financial skills, CMAs are ideal for business analyst roles in tech companies, consulting firms, and MNCs.
- Financial Controller
A senior position responsible for managing budgeting, internal controls, and financial operations. CMAs often move into this role after a few years of experience.
- Corporate Finance Executive
From analysing investments to evaluating risk, CMAs are well positioned for corporate finance roles where business strategy meets financial intelligence.
- Risk Manager
Companies need professionals who can identify risks, build mitigation plans, and ensure compliance. CMA-trained professionals excel because they understand both numbers and strategy.
- Operations & Strategy Manager
Since CMA teaches how business decisions impact financial performance, many CMAs transition into operations, process improvement, or strategy roles.
CMA USA Salary in India: What to Expect
One of the biggest attractions of the CMA USA qualification is the strong salary potential. While actual salaries vary based on experience, location, and company, CMAs in India generally earn significantly higher than non-certified finance professionals.
Here’s an approximate overview:
- Fresh CMA professionals: ₹5–8 LPA
- Mid-level CMAs (3–5 years experience): ₹8–15 LPA
- Senior roles (FP&A, Controller, Strategy): ₹15–25 LPA
- Top positions (CFO, Finance Director, Senior Manager): ₹25–50+ LPA
CMAs working with MNCs, Big 4s, and tech companies (like Accenture, Amazon, IBM, EY, Deloitte, PwC) often receive even higher compensation due to the strategic nature of their roles.
When compared to traditional accounting qualifications with longer durations, CMA USA offers one of the best ROI in terms of time, effort, and career growth.
